Jarinu, like a local
Don't miss
- Parque da Cidade: A beautiful park perfect for picnics and outdoor activities.
- Igreja Matriz de Jarinu: An architectural gem that reflects the city's history.
- Cascata do Avelino: A hidden waterfall ideal for nature lovers and photographers.
- Museu Histórico de Jarinu: Offers insights into the local history and culture.
Where to eat
- Pizzaria do Porto: Known for its delicious wood-fired pizzas.
- Restaurante Sabor da Roça: Serves traditional Brazilian dishes in a rustic setting.
- Café com Prosa: A cozy café famous for its artisanal coffee and pastries.
Do this
- Festa do Colono: A local festival celebrating the agricultural heritage of Jarinu.
- Caminhada Ecológica: Guided eco-walks showcasing the region’s natural beauty.
- Feira de Artesanato: A vibrant craft fair featuring local artisans and handmade goods.
Local tips
- Visit local markets on weekends for fresh produce and unique finds.
- Try the local cachaça at small distilleries for an authentic taste.
- Join community events to experience local culture and meet residents.
- Use public transportation for a more authentic and economical way to explore.
Know before you go
Best time
Apr-Jun, Sep-Oct. These months offer milder temperatures and less rainfall, ideal for outdoor activities.
Getting around
Buses and taxis are the main forms of public transport; ridesharing apps like Uber and Bolt are widely used.
Airport
SAO
Language
Portuguese
Money
Brazilian Real (BRL). Credit cards are widely accepted, but carry cash for local markets.
Safety
Jarinu is relatively safe, but standard precautions should be taken, especially at night.
